1. Best Awards from Institutions and Governments
The top universities in Moldova receive direct funding to stay the best in the region in health and technical sciences.
International Scholarships from the Technical University of Moldova (UTM)
- Status: Active through 2026 and 2027.
- The Opportunity: UTM has started fully funded scholarships just for its flagship English-taught programmes, which are Software Engineering and Veterinary Medicine.
- • The Coverage: This award is a full-ride scholarship that pays for all tuition costs for the entire programme, which lasts four years for engineering and six years for integrated veterinary medicine.
- • Target: International students who do well in school. You usually need to pass a math and English test to enrol, but those with B2-level certificates are exempt.
“Nicolae Testemitanu” State University of Medicine and Pharmacy
- Status: Direct Discounts Based on Merit.
- The Chance: Full “entry” scholarships for all international students are rare, but the university does offer merit-based discounts to students who do well in their first year.
- Cost Context: These internal waivers are very competitive because the cost of tuition for Medicine and Pharmacy is about $5,700 and for dentistry, it is $6,350.
- • Language: The programs are offered only in English, which attracts a lot of students from over 30 countries.
2. Fellowships for EU and Regional Exchange
Moldova is a member of European funding frameworks and gives out mobility grants for both long-term and short-term study.
Erasmus+ International Credit Mobility (ICM)
- Current Window: A contest for mobility (for example, with partner universities in Latvia) just ended on April 6, 2026, but there are other similar calls from institutions throughout the Spring.
- The Opportunity: Students from partner universities can study in Moldova for a semester and get a monthly stipend of about €800 and travel expenses covered.
- Fields: The program places significant emphasis on business administration, tourism, and engineering.
Central European Exchange Programme (CEEPUS)
- The deadline for the Winter Semester is June 15, 2026.
- The Opportunity: For students from Central and Eastern Europe who want to do research and study abroad at Moldovan state universities. It pays for tuition and gives you a stipend to cover living expenses in the area.
